Now that presidential hopeful Donald Trump is out of the way, NBC is moving full speed ahead with the task of ensuring that Season 8 of hit staple Celebrity Apprentice continues its streak of drama-filled fodder. And based on the roster of stars added to the mix – there is certainly going to be a plethora of must-see moments emanating from the famous boardroom.
As usual – the celebs that will be competing for the ultimate title and stamped validation have been purposely selected to provide the utmost level of entertainment that won’t disappoint especially when you add Jersey Shore’s fireball – Nicole “Snooki” Polizzi to the list.
Yep, it has been confirmed that the Reality TV star will be a participant alongside two staples of the Real Housewives franchise – Kyle Richards (Beverly Hills) and Porsha Williams (Atlanta). The rest of the cast includes, Culture Club lead singer, Boy George, Wilson Phillips very own Carnie Wilson, funnyman and SNL alum Jon Lovitz, Laila Ali – the daughter of icon Mohammed Ali who like her father enjoyed a measure of success inside the ring, Vince Neil from Motley Crue, Queer Eye’s Carson Kressley – who looks even weirder now than he did then, former host of Dancing with the Stars, Brooke Burke-Charvet, and former host of Big Morning Buzz Live, Carrie Keagan.
Martial artist Chael Sonnen, former football star Eric Dickerson, America Ninja Warrior host Matt Iseman, and Heismann Trophy recipient Ricky Williams round out the colorful team of competitors.
And if you think that group selection sounds otherworldly – wait till you get a load of the new set of judges that will be deciding the fate of the budding entrepreneurs.
Arnold Schwarzenegger will take over Trump’s role as the show’s host which means he has the final say. He will also have a slew of prominent guests stopping by to support his efforts. Warren Buffet, Honest Company co-founder, Jessica Alba, Tyra Banks, Los Angeles Clippers owner Steve Ballmer and the Terminator actor’s nephew Patrick Knapp Schwarzenegger have all been confirmed as guest judges.
Although no premiere date has been announced – we can assume that NBC will not miss The Donald at all. Not with this very ambitious lineup and the anticipation that the former governor of California’s parting line to the eliminated contestant will be “You’re Terminated’.
